-
- All Superinterfaces:
Comparable<CharValue>,Mirror,PrimitiveValue,Value
public interface CharValue extends PrimitiveValue, Comparable<CharValue>
Provides access to a primitivecharvalue in the target VM.- Since:
- 1.3
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description booleanequals(Object obj)Compares the specified Object with this CharValue for equality.inthashCode()Returns the hash code value for this CharValue.charvalue()Returns this CharValue as achar.-
Methods inherited from interface java.lang.Comparable
compareTo
-
Methods inherited from interface com.sun.jdi.Mirror
toString, virtualMachine
-
Methods inherited from interface com.sun.jdi.PrimitiveValue
booleanValue, byteValue, charValue, doubleValue, floatValue, intValue, longValue, shortValue
-
-
-
-
Method Detail
-
value
char value()
Returns this CharValue as achar.- Returns:
- the
charmirrored by this object.
-
equals
boolean equals(Object obj)
Compares the specified Object with this CharValue for equality.- Overrides:
equalsin classObject- Parameters:
obj- the reference object with which to compare.- Returns:
- true if the Object is a CharValue and if applying "==" to the two mirrored primitives would evaluate to true; false otherwise.
- See Also:
Object.hashCode(),HashMap
-
hashCode
int hashCode()
Returns the hash code value for this CharValue.- Overrides:
hashCodein classObject- Returns:
- the integer hash code
- See Also:
Object.equals(java.lang.Object),System.identityHashCode(java.lang.Object)
-
-